About this House

Nice, well-updated home with country privacy. Under 10 minutes to Greenville, Winterville, Ayden and Farmville. 3 bdrm 2 bath house on .75-acre private lot on country road. Fully remodeled in 2017. Central electric air and heat. Single car carport. Large deck. 12x16 storage shed with electricity. Additional attic and crawl-space storage. Laundry room (hookups). Wood and vinyl-plank floors. Kitchen breakfast-table space. Two large rooms for living/dining. Large master bath with separate tub and shower, two sinks and two master-bed closets. Greene county schools. Broadband internet is available.
Water is included in rent. Tenant responsible for electricity and mowing.

Tenant responsible for mowing (.75 acre), electricity and internet service.
